When a child picks up a toy, they will bend at the hips, knees and ankles; as adults we tend to fix these joints and bend from the waist. This puts enormous strain on our muscles and joints, whilst our sedentary lives lead to poor activation of postural muscles.
The teacher recognises proven pain-producing behaviour and facilitates coordination, functioning and mobility of joints and lengthening of the spine, thus reducing spasm and pain.
Practicing the Technique involves using inhibition to over-ride the anticipatory pre-emptive response that we usually have when presented with any stimulus.
Through a light touch and verbal suggestions the teacher guides the pupil to recognise how to restore a better overall balance.
The Alexander Technique is an educational method rather than a therapy (although most people find their lessons very therapeutic, as relaxing as a massage and you are learning something) and is taught on a one-to-one basis.

The Technique results in a general feeling of lightness and well-being.
The idea is that you take away from the very first lesson tools to use which will help you with your individual area of difficulty.
A typical lesson lasts for 30-45 minutes. All you have to do is wear loose comfortable clothing and be prepared to take your shoes off. You are never too old to begin!
